caret
Um caret (às vezes chamado de "cursor de texto") é um indicador exibido na tela para indicar onde a entrada de texto será inserida. A maioria das interfaces de usuário representam o caret usando uma linha vertical fina ou uma caixa do tamanho de um caractere que pisca, mas isso pode variar. Este ponto do texto é chamado de ponto de inserção. A palavra "careta" diferencia o ponto de inserção de texto do cursor do mouse.
Na web, um caret é usado para representar o ponto de inserção em <input> e <textarea> elementos, bem como quaisquer elementos cujo atributo contenteditable está definido, permitindo assim que o conteúdo do elemento seja editado pelo usuário.
Saiba Mais
>Conhecimento geral
- Caret navigation no Wikipedia
CSS relacionado com o caret
Você pode definir a cor do caret para o conteúdo editável de um determinado elemento definindo a propriedade CSS caret-color para o valor apropriado <color>
Elementos HTML que podem apresentar um caret
Esses elementos fornecem campos de entrada de texto ou caixas e, portanto, fazem uso do caret.
<input type="text"><input type="password"><input type="search"><input type="date">,<input type="time">,<input type="datetime">e<input type="datetime-local"><input type="number">,<input type="range"><input type="email">,<input type="tel">e<input type="url"><textarea>- Qualquer elemento com seu conjunto de atributo
contenteditable.